Photos: Mourning the victims of the Ankara attacks

October 12, 2015 1:36PM ET

Funerals across Turkey in memory of the dozens killed in bombings

Relatives mourn near the coffin of Korkmaz Tedik, a board member of the Turkish Labor Party, October 11, 2015, who was killed in twin bombings in Ankara the day before. Bulent Kilic / AFP / Getty Images
Turkey Ankara bombings
On Sunday and Monday, funerals were held all over Turkey for the dozens of victims of the bombings. Bulent Kilic / AFP / Getty Images

A pair of shoes belonging to a street vendor who was selling simit, a traditional Turkish bread, are placed at the bombing scene during a commemoration for victims of the blasts in Ankara, October 12, 2015. Umit Bektas / Reuters
